FSU College of Medicine receives $3M grant to support pediatric stress research

Tallahassee-based Florida State University College of Medicine received a $3 million grant from the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ration to advance research on pediatric stress in the children of rural and migrant farm-workers.

The five-year grant will support efforts to develop and validate treatments and interventions to mitigate childhood traumatic stress.

"Children in rural areas face a number of challenges in getting treatment for behavioral and emotional problems, including availability of such services, accessibility and acceptability. In addition, migrant families are impacted by a scarcity of linguistically and culturally appropriate services." said Javier Rosado, PhD, FSU College of Medicine's clinical associate professor and co-director of the grant project.
